Key Features of the Home Energy Improvement Program Rebate Application
This rebate application includes several essential features necessary for successful submission. Applicants must provide vital information such as:
-
Type of home
-
Methods of heating and cooling
-
Project cost details
Supplementary documentation such as invoices and comprehensive project details are also required. Finally, both the customer and contractor must provide signatures to validate the application.

What are the eligibility requirements for the Home Energy Improvement Program Rebate Application?
Eligibility typically requires homeowners to have undertaken eligible duct sealing or repair work as part of an energy efficiency improvement project. Contractors must be approved by the utility provider.
Is there a deadline for submitting the rebate application?
Yes, the application must be submitted along with an invoice within 90 days of the project's completion to qualify for the rebate.
How can I submit the rebate application?
You can submit the completed rebate application online through pdfFiller or by mailing a printed version along with your invoice to the specified address. Make sure to check submission methods allowed by your utility provider.
What supporting documents are required to complete the application?
You will need to provide an invoice of the duct sealing or repair work completed, along with information about the type of home and the efficiency improvements made.
What common mistakes should I avoid while filling out the form?
Ensure you complete all fields accurately and do not omit signatures from both customer and contractor. Double-check to avoid spelling errors or incorrect project details.
How long does it take to process the rebate application?
Processing times can vary, but typically, you should expect to receive a response within 4 to 6 weeks from the date of submission, depending on the utility provider.
